Most Popular College Majors in the United States

Hey everyone, I'm a junior wondering what the most popular college majors currently are in the United States. Have you noticed any trends in segments of study that are gaining popularity? I want to make sure I'm making informed decisions about my academic future, so any insights would be appreciated!

a year ago

Hello! That's a great question. Firstly, let's look at some of the most popular majors, these are ones that consistently see a high number of students. All data is continually changing, but Business Administration and Management remains the most popular major in the U.S. Many students are also drawn to Psychology, Nursing, Biology, and Engineering as they are practical and versatile areas of study.

As for fields that are growing in popularity, anything related to health or technology usually sees consistent growth. For example, majors in Public Health, Computer Science, and Bioengineering have all seen increased interest recently. Additionally, data science and analytics majors are becoming more and more popular due to the high demand for professionals who can interpret and analyze information in meaningful ways.

However, it's essential to remember that while trends and popularity can be informative, you should consider your interests, long-term career goals, and where your talents lie when choosing a major. Select a field of study that you're passionate about and one where you could envision yourself building a prosperous career. This way, your academic journey will be more enjoyable, and you'll be more likely to excel in your chosen field.
